Flights wait for no one
ALL flights with China Southern Airlines started
following strict time schedules Sunday closing check-in
counters 30 minutes before take-off. It now also forbids
boarding 15 minutes ahead of take-off to secure normal flight
operations. A survey showed that a total of 5,562 passengers
were late for flights departing Guangzhou in August, keeping
other passengers waiting by delaying take-off.
Jobless rate controls
GUANGDONG Province will try to create 700,000 new jobs
each year over the following three years and keep the jobless
rate within four percent, the provincial labor and social
security administration announced Friday. With an annual
provincial economic growth of 10 percent, 600,000 new
positions would be created. The other 100,000 jobs could be
achieved by providing community services, officials said.
22 new parks for GZ
GUANGZHOU is planning to build 22 new parks within the
next five years, local media reported yesterday. By 2005, 30
percent of the city’s downtown area will be covered by
greenery, the municipal landscape authorities said.
